I added one hole at each side of the chassis for the cells. I extended the chassis because the axles doesn't didn't seem to fit. I use savage axles for the f/c and r/c diff. The length of the chassis is now 494. That is huge man! Is it no to huge?

The upperdeck is completely changed. I made a new design. I added two holes for the savage steering and I made some space for the motor behind the motormount.

Now I need to design the shocktowers. I try to finish that this weekend because monday my friends vacation is over and the is going to school. So he can cut my design out :)
